What are the key differences between lab-grown diamonds and natural diamonds?

Lab-grown diamonds and natural diamonds share the same physical and chemical properties, but they are created through different processes. Lab-grown diamonds are produced in a controlled environment using advanced technological methods, while natural diamonds are formed over billions of years within the Earth’s mantle. Both options offer brilliance and durability, yet differ in origin and potential ethical considerations.

Lab-grown diamonds and natural diamonds, while visually and chemically similar, differ fundamentally in their creation process. Lab-grown diamonds are synthesised in controlled environments using techniques like Chemical Vapour Deposition (CVD) or High Pressure High Temperature (HPHT), which replicate the natural conditions diamonds experience over millennia in the Earth’s mantle. In contrast, natural diamonds are mined from the Earth, formed naturally over a period spanning billions of years.

A significant point of difference is their environmental footprint. Lab-grown diamonds offer a more sustainable option due to their reduced impact on land and ecosystems compared to traditional mining practices. From a quality perspective, both lab-grown and natural diamonds exhibit similar physical properties, such as hardness and optical brilliance, making them equally durable and beautiful for jewellery like bespoke engagement rings. However, lab-grown diamonds can often be offered at a more competitive price point due to their manufacturing process, providing an appealing choice for budget-conscious clients without compromising on quality or authenticity.
